Chigger larva will attach to your clothing and move to your skin to feed. The chigger larva will release a liquid chemical into your skin to kill skin cells (digestive enzyme). The dead skin cells form a tiny straw (stylostome) for the chigger to drink your skin tissue. The chigger’s chemical causes itchingthat is very intense … See more Chiggers (trombiculidae) are a species of mite, and are a close relative to spiders and ticks. Chiggers are microscopic and are almost invisible to … See more Chigger bites can affect anyone who might pick chiggers up on their clothing outdoors in grassy, wet or wooded areas. See more Chigger bites are very common in the summer months when temperatures are warm to hot. Many people don’t report chigger bites, so the actual number of cases is unknown. See more Chiggers live in grass or wooded areas and attach to your clothing.
